Harvard School of Dental Medicine Honours Two Distinguished Members as 2025 Harvard Heroes

The Harvard School of Dental Medicine (HSDM) is set to celebrate two of its esteemed members, Carrie Sylven and Adrien Doherty, as the 2025 Harvard Heroes. This recognition is a part of the Harvard Heroes Recognition Program, which honours staff for their significant contributions to the university.

Carrie Sylven, a key figure in the Office of Dental Education, has been the director of Student Affairs since 2015. Her dedication to shaping a supportive and inclusive academic environment has been instrumental in the success of HSDM. Sylven finds supporting students to be the heart of her work and is deeply honoured to be recognized as an HSDM Harvard Hero.

Sylven's nominators praised her for her hard work, professionalism, authenticity, and empathy. She consistently ensures that student needs are at the heart of HSDM's mission, making her a widely recognized passionate advocate for students.

Adrien Doherty, a valued member of the Office of Dental Education team, began his Harvard career at the Divinity School in 2010. After advancing to his current position as academic societies coordinator, Doherty has been a pillar of support for students, faculty, and staff at HSDM. His nominators praised his dedication, wisdom, and heart in all his tasks.

Doherty's longstanding commitment to the Harvard community was further highlighted this past year when he celebrated a twenty-year Harvard service milestone. His efforts have not gone unnoticed, and he expressed his gratitude for being recognized as an HSDM Harvard Hero.

The Harvard Heroes Celebration will be livestreamed, and both Sylven and Doherty will be recognised on June 12 at Sanders Theatre. The event is a testament to the significant impact these individuals have made on the Harvard community, particularly at the School of Dental Medicine.
